Understanding Personal Lubricants
Personal lubricants are substances designed to reduce friction and enhance comfort during intimate activities. They can be used to alleviate vaginal dryness, improve sexual pleasure, and prevent discomfort or pain. There are several types of personal lubricants available, including water-based, silicone-based, oil-based, and hybrid lubricants. Each type has its unique characteristics, advantages, and disadvantages.
Types of Personal Lubricants
Water-based lubricants are the most common type and are suitable for most users. They are easy to clean up, non-staining, and compatible with latex condoms. However, they can be less effective for extended periods and may require reapplication. Silicone-based lubricants, on the other hand, are more durable and long-lasting, making them ideal for extended play or use with sex toys. They are also non-staining and hypoallergenic but can be more expensive than water-based lubricants.
Characteristics of Personal Lubricants
When choosing a personal lubricant, there are several factors to consider. Lubricating properties are essential, as they determine how well the product reduces friction and enhances comfort. Other important characteristics include skin compatibility, odor and taste, and texture. Some lubricants may have a strong scent or taste, while others may be fragrance-free and hypoallergenic. The texture of a lubricant can also vary, ranging from thin and watery to thick and gel-like.

What are the drawbacks of using KY Jelly as a personal lubricant?
KY Jelly, a popular personal lubricant, has several drawbacks that may make it less desirable for some users. One of the main issues with KY Jelly is its high glycerin content, which can cause irritation and discomfort in some individuals, particularly those with sensitive skin. Additionally, KY Jelly is a water-based lubricant, which means it can evaporate quickly, leading to reduced effectiveness and the need for frequent reapplication. This can be especially problematic during prolonged sexual activity or for individuals who experience vaginal dryness.
Furthermore, KY Jelly’s ingredients and pH level may not be suitable for all users, particularly those with certain medical conditions or who are using specific types of condoms. For example, KY Jelly’s high pH level can disrupt the natural balance of the vagina, potentially leading to yeast infections or other issues. Moreover, its glycerin content can also contribute to the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ms, which can increase the risk of infection. As a result, many individuals are seeking alternative personal lubricants that are gentler, more effective, and better suited to their specific needs and preferences.

How do silicone-based personal lubricants differ from water-based lubricants?
Silicone-based personal lubricants differ significantly from water-based lubricants like KY Jelly in terms of their composition, texture, and performance. Silicone lubricants are typically made from a blend of silicone oils and other ingredients, which provide a smooth, velvety texture and a high level of lubricity. Unlike water-based lubricants, which can evaporate quickly, silicone lubricants are more resistant to evaporation and can provide a longer-lasting experience. This makes them an excellent option for individuals who engage in prolonged sexual activity or who experience vaginal dryness.
In addition to their improved longevity, silicone-based personal lubricants may also offer other benefits, such as enhanced comfort and reduced irritation. For example, silicone lubricants can help to reduce friction and irritation, making them an excellent option for individuals with sensitive skin or those who experience discomfort during sex. Moreover, silicone lubricants are often hypoallergenic and non-comedogenic, meaning they are less likely to cause allergic reactions or clog pores. However, it’s essential to note that silicone lubricants may not be compatible with all types of sex toys or condoms, so it’s crucial to choose a lubricant that is specifically designed for your needs and preferences.

How do I choose the best personal lubricant for my needs?
Choosing the best personal lubricant for your needs requires consideration of several factors, including your personal preferences, skin type, and intended use. First, it’s essential to determine the type of lubricant you need, such as water-based, silicone-based, or oil-based. Water-based lubricants are generally the most versatile and suitable for most users, while silicone-based lubricants are better suited for individuals who engage in prolonged sexual activity or experience vaginal dryness. Oil-based lubricants, on the other hand, are often used for massage or as a moisturizer.
In addition to the type of lubricant, it’s also essential to consider the ingredients, pH level, and texture. Individuals with sensitive skin or allergies should opt for hypoallergenic and fragrance-free lubricants, while those who experience vaginal dryness may prefer a lubricant with moisturizing properties. The pH level of the lubricant is also crucial, as a lubricant with a high pH level can disrupt the natural balance of the vagina and cause irritation. By considering these factors and reading reviews from other users, individuals can choose a personal lubricant that meets their needs and provides a comfortable and enjoyable experience.

Can personal lubricants be used with sex toys and condoms?
Yes, personal lubricants can be used with sex toys and condoms, but it’s essential to choose a lubricant that is compatible with these products. For example, silicone-based lubricants should not be used with silicone sex toys, as they can cause the toy to break down or become damaged. Similarly, oil-based lubricants should not be used with latex condoms, as they can cause the condom to deteriorate or break. Water-based lubricants, on the other hand, are generally safe to use with most sex toys and condoms.
When using a personal lubricant with a sex toy or condom, it’s essential to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and to choose a lubricant that is specifically designed for this purpose. Some lubricants are designed specifically for use with sex toys, while others are designed for use with condoms. By choosing the right lubricant and using it correctly, individuals can enjoy a safe and pleasurable experience with their sex toys and condoms. It’s also crucial to clean and maintain sex toys properly to prevent the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ms, and to always use a new condom for each use to reduce the risk of infection.
